Transaction 4c6cac3384a57040e75816975557b38149f538ce0f873906836181390c0ace04

3 Input
2 Outputs
  • 4c6cac3384a57040e75816975557b38149f538ce0f873906836181390c0ace04:0
  • value  1086273
    address  3MXrg6eiiZHJYEUX8qSikSH8xbG61T7LEc
  • 4c6cac3384a57040e75816975557b38149f538ce0f873906836181390c0ace04:1
  • value  44933131
    address  36iUD1f2ovYmN6JQJ3cuLXJUyBiBJPf56s